Bluetooth v HA

Home Assistant CZ drbna
Uživatelský avatar
Dušan
Dárce - Donátor
Dárce - Donátor
Příspěvky: 358
Registrován: 30. březen 2021, 08:25
Dal poděkování: 24 poděkování
Dostal poděkování: 29 poděkování

Bluetooth v HA

Příspěvek od Dušan »

Zdravím, vlastním reproduktor JBL BoomBox, který lze připojit přes Bluetooth k telefonu a poslouchat muziku.
Chtěl jsem se zeptat, jestli by bylo možné nějak repráček integrovat do HA přes Bluetooth aspoň jako entitu ( aktivní, neaktivní )
Předem děkuji za reakce.
Rpi 4 8GB RAM Home assistant běží na ssd, Esp, Sonoff ještě pořád jde, Tasmotka je hodně dobrá, ale Tuya nebrat :D GigaBlue + oscam , TV Philips 70" síť Unifi, GW 10K ET+ , Dynes 10kWh, 8.1kwp

Uživatelský avatar
Lion®
Administrátor fóra
Administrátor fóra
Příspěvky: 1597
Registrován: 28. září 2020, 14:07
Bydliště: podkrkonoší
Dal poděkování: 144 poděkování
Dostal poděkování: 192 poděkování
Kontaktovat uživatele:

Re: Bluetooth v HA

Příspěvek od Lion® »

Ahoj,
tak jestli je speaker aktivní nebo ne (připojený nebo nepřipojený k mobilu) Ti řekne atribut

Kód: Vybrat vše

connected_paired_devices: '[xx:xx:xx:xx:xx:xx]'
entity:

Kód: Vybrat vše

sensor.tvuj_mobilni_telefon_pripojeni_bluetooth
Pokud takovou entitu nemáš, bude nutné ji v mobilním zařízení s HomeAssistant aktivovat.
Nastavení aplikace - Senzory (správa senzorů) - Senzory Bluetooth - Připojení Bluetooth - Povolit
To udělej se všemi mobilními zařízeními a pak jen malá automatizace která bude zjišťovat zda je speaker připojen k některému z nich.

Tak zjistíš jestli je aktivní nebo ne. Pokud potřebuješ vědět jestli hraje nebo nehraje zkusil bych využít v mobilních zařízeních :
Senzory Statistik provozu
________________
🍻 Přispěj a získej přístup do obsahu fóra pro dárce. :thx:
Oficiální sada s Raspberry Pi 4B/4GB, černá +Argon NEO Raspberry Pi 4 Case
Patriot Burst 2.5" SATA SSD 120GB + AXAGON EE25-XA6 ALINE box

Galerie realizací

Uživatelský avatar
Dušan
Dárce - Donátor
Dárce - Donátor
Příspěvky: 358
Registrován: 30. březen 2021, 08:25
Dal poděkování: 24 poděkování
Dostal poděkování: 29 poděkování

Re: Bluetooth v HA

Příspěvek od Dušan »

Ahoj, přesně tohle jsem zkoušel včera a píše mi pouze " 1 connection " a já bych potřeboval přesný název připojeného zařízení.
Např. JBL online/offline
Screenshot_20210819-124342_Home Assistant.jpg
Screenshot_20210819-124351_Home Assistant.jpg
Rpi 4 8GB RAM Home assistant běží na ssd, Esp, Sonoff ještě pořád jde, Tasmotka je hodně dobrá, ale Tuya nebrat :D GigaBlue + oscam , TV Philips 70" síť Unifi, GW 10K ET+ , Dynes 10kWh, 8.1kwp

Uživatelský avatar
Lion®
Administrátor fóra
Administrátor fóra
Příspěvky: 1597
Registrován: 28. září 2020, 14:07
Bydliště: podkrkonoší
Dal poděkování: 144 poděkování
Dostal poděkování: 192 poděkování
Kontaktovat uživatele:

Re: Bluetooth v HA

Příspěvek od Lion® »

Však tak je to správně.

Já mluvím ještě o atributu entity.
Ta říká :

connected_paired_devices: - tam máš Mac adresu konkrétního připojeného zařízení
IMG_20210819_134758.jpg
Pak už Je to jednoduché.
Vytvoř pomocníka přepínač s názvem Reproduktor (input_boolean.reproduktor).
Napiš automatizaci ve smyslu:
pokud je atribut entity connected_paired_devices shodný s mac adresou repráků prepni pomocnika do on pokud není atribut shodný s mac adresou repráků prepni pomocnika do off
Do lovelace si pak dej toho pomocníka.
________________
🍻 Přispěj a získej přístup do obsahu fóra pro dárce. :thx:
Oficiální sada s Raspberry Pi 4B/4GB, černá +Argon NEO Raspberry Pi 4 Case
Patriot Burst 2.5" SATA SSD 120GB + AXAGON EE25-XA6 ALINE box

Galerie realizací

Uživatelský avatar
Dušan
Dárce - Donátor
Dárce - Donátor
Příspěvky: 358
Registrován: 30. březen 2021, 08:25
Dal poděkování: 24 poděkování
Dostal poděkování: 29 poděkování

Re: Bluetooth v HA

Příspěvek od Dušan »

Asi se nechápeme. Já bych potřeboval entitu, aby měla název například: "REPRODUKTOR" a svítila žlutě jako připojeno nebo modře odpojeno.
název: 1 connection a mac adresa je mi k ničemu, když nevím k čemu patří.Samozřejmě já vím k čemu patří, ale třeba moje žena nebo dcera to neví.
Aby to vypadalo nějak takto jako v kotelne bojler.
Screenshot_20210819-135856_Home Assistant.jpg
Rpi 4 8GB RAM Home assistant běží na ssd, Esp, Sonoff ještě pořád jde, Tasmotka je hodně dobrá, ale Tuya nebrat :D GigaBlue + oscam , TV Philips 70" síť Unifi, GW 10K ET+ , Dynes 10kWh, 8.1kwp

Uživatelský avatar
Lion®
Administrátor fóra
Administrátor fóra
Příspěvky: 1597
Registrován: 28. září 2020, 14:07
Bydliště: podkrkonoší
Dal poděkování: 144 poděkování
Dostal poděkování: 192 poděkování
Kontaktovat uživatele:

Re: Bluetooth v HA

Příspěvek od Lion® »

Chápu Tě.

Vytvoř pomocníka přepínač s názvem Reproduktor (input_boolean.reproduktor).
Napiš automatizaci ve smyslu:
pokud je atribut entity connected_paired_devices shodný s mac adresou repráků prepni pomocnika do on pokud není atribut shodný s mac adresou repráků prepni pomocnika do off
Do lovelace si pak dej toho pomocníka.
________________
🍻 Přispěj a získej přístup do obsahu fóra pro dárce. :thx:
Oficiální sada s Raspberry Pi 4B/4GB, černá +Argon NEO Raspberry Pi 4 Case
Patriot Burst 2.5" SATA SSD 120GB + AXAGON EE25-XA6 ALINE box

Galerie realizací

PepYk_
Pokročilý
Pokročilý
Příspěvky: 112
Registrován: 03. květen 2021, 12:29
Dal poděkování: 2 poděkování
Dostal poděkování: 20 poděkování

Re: Bluetooth v HA

Příspěvek od PepYk_ »

Tak, teď jsem na Dušana zvědavý, jestli tu automatizaci udělá, když jsi mu to Lione tak pěkně popsal ;) V podstatě může mít ty přepínače stavu tři, tedy pro telefon svůj, dcery i ženy.

Uživatelský avatar
Dušan
Dárce - Donátor
Dárce - Donátor
Příspěvky: 358
Registrován: 30. březen 2021, 08:25
Dal poděkování: 24 poděkování
Dostal poděkování: 29 poděkování

Re: Bluetooth v HA

Příspěvek od Dušan »

Pomocníka mám vytvořenýho, jen jsem se zasekl jak mám napsat tu automatizaci.

Kód: Vybrat vše

alias: Repro on
description: ''
trigger:
  - platform: state
    entity_id: sensor.samsung_s20_bluetooth_connection
    attribute: connected_paired_devices
condition:
  - condition: device
    device_id: ''
    domain: ''
    entity_id: ''
action:
  - service: input_boolean.turn_on
    target:
      entity_id: input_boolean.reproduktor
mode: single
Rpi 4 8GB RAM Home assistant běží na ssd, Esp, Sonoff ještě pořád jde, Tasmotka je hodně dobrá, ale Tuya nebrat :D GigaBlue + oscam , TV Philips 70" síť Unifi, GW 10K ET+ , Dynes 10kWh, 8.1kwp

PepYk_
Pokročilý
Pokročilý
Příspěvky: 112
Registrován: 03. květen 2021, 12:29
Dal poděkování: 2 poděkování
Dostal poděkování: 20 poděkování

Re: Bluetooth v HA

Příspěvek od PepYk_ »

Душан píše: 19. srpen 2021, 14:47 Pomocníka mám vytvořenýho, jen jsem se zasekl jak mám napsat tu automatizaci.

Kód: Vybrat vše

alias: Repro on
description: ''
trigger:
  - platform: state
    entity_id: sensor.samsung_s20_bluetooth_connection
    attribute: connected_paired_devices
condition:
  - condition: device
    device_id: ''
    domain: ''
    entity_id: ''
action:
  - service: input_boolean.turn_on
    target:
      entity_id: input_boolean.reproduktor
mode: single
Nedal jsi to a já ti docela věřil. Lion ti vše potřebné napsal a to docela podrobně. Proč si s tím nezkusíš poradit sám a chvíli lámeš hlavu a hned sem flákneš příspěvěk, že ti to nejde... Takhle se nic nenaučíš ;)

Uživatelský avatar
Dušan
Dárce - Donátor
Dárce - Donátor
Příspěvky: 358
Registrován: 30. březen 2021, 08:25
Dal poděkování: 24 poděkování
Dostal poděkování: 29 poděkování

Re: Bluetooth v HA

Příspěvek od Dušan »

PepYku ty syčáku jeden :lol: :lol: já si s tím lámu hlavu už 3 dny. Ale už to snad mám a bude to makat.
Lione díky za nakopnutí :P paráda.

Pro zapnutí:

Kód: Vybrat vše

alias: Repro on
description: ''
trigger:
  - platform: state
    entity_id: sensor.samsung_s20_bluetooth_connection
    attribute: connected_paired_devices
    to: '[98:52:3D:D2:CC:AD]'
condition: []
action:
  - service: input_boolean.turn_on
    target:
      entity_id: input_boolean.reproduktor
mode: single
Pro vypnutí naopak mac: adresu
Rpi 4 8GB RAM Home assistant běží na ssd, Esp, Sonoff ještě pořád jde, Tasmotka je hodně dobrá, ale Tuya nebrat :D GigaBlue + oscam , TV Philips 70" síť Unifi, GW 10K ET+ , Dynes 10kWh, 8.1kwp

Odpovědět

Zpět na „Všeobecná diskuse“